A party like no other

While the Bridal Buyer Awards evening lets you raise a glass with winners, it also provides a great opportunity to socialise with peers and celebrate just how great the bridal industry is

The black-tie event attracts over 600 guests from all sectors of our industry; including retailers, suppliers, designers and the media, making it the perfect place to celebrate.

Winning a Bridal Buyer Award – or making it as far as finalist – can do wonders for your business, and it’s important for us to recognise the dedication so many people in this industry have. But there’s more to this event than that – the Awards evening is about coming together and celebrating this industry… and recognising why it’s one you can be proud to be a part of.
